Yola
[edit]Noun
[edit]greound
- Alternative form of greoune
- 1867, OBSERVATIONS BY THE EDITOR, page 15:
- F. greound, keow, meouth, pleough, sneow, steout.
- E. ground, cow, mouth, plough, snow, stout.
- 1867, “BIT OF DIALOGUE”, in SONGS, ETC. IN THE DIALECT OF FORTH AND BARGY, page 111:
- Aar's a dole o' sneow apa greound to-die.
- There is a deal of snow upon the ground to-day.
